Overview: Snapdragon X Elite X1E-80-100 Processor

The Snapdragon X Elite X1E-80-100, launched in October 2023, is an advanced 12-core processor designed using the innovative Oryon architecture. Developed for modern laptops, this processor delivers remarkable performance, energy efficiency, and intelligent capabilities. Featuring Qualcomm Adreno X1 Graphics, compatibility with LPDDR5x memory, and the powerful Qualcomm Hexagon NPU, the Snapdragon X Elite X1E-80-100 caters to the diverse needs of gamers, professionals, and creators, making it an exceptional choice for high-demand computing environments.

Features and Specifications

Core Configuration for Exceptional Speed

  • Total Cores: 12 Performance Cores (P-Cores)
    • Base Frequency: 3.8 GHz
    • Boost Frequency: 4 GHz

The 12-core architecture ensures smooth multitasking and optimized performance for intensive workflows, including gaming, content creation, and professional applications. The processor’s high base and boost frequencies allow consistent speed and efficiency across demanding tasks.

Qualcomm Adreno X1 Graphics for Immersive Visuals

  • Base Frequency: 300 MHz
  • Boost Frequency: 1200 MHz
  • Shading Units: 1536
  • TMUs: 48
  • ROPs: 6
  • IGPU Power: 3.8 TFLOPS

Integrated Qualcomm Adreno X1 Graphics delivers vibrant visuals and seamless rendering, providing robust support for gaming, media playback, and creative workflows. With 3.8 TFLOPS of graphical power, users can enjoy immersive and detailed experiences for a range of applications.

Memory and Display Compatibility

  • Memory Support: LPDDR5x – Up to 8448 MT/s (Up to 64 GB)
  • Maximum Display Resolution: 3840 × 2160 @ 120Hz

The processor supports high-speed LPDDR5x memory, ensuring efficient multitasking and rapid data transfer rates. Its compatibility with 4K displays at 120Hz provides sharp and fluid visuals, ideal for professional and entertainment-focused scenarios.

AI Optimization with Qualcomm Hexagon NPU

  • Neural Processing Unit (NPU): Qualcomm Hexagon NPU
  • Performance Power: 45 TOPS

The Qualcomm Hexagon NPU introduces intelligent multitasking and system optimization, driving next-generation AI solutions. With 45 TOPS of power, it supports tasks like voice recognition, machine learning, and advanced system enhancements.

Energy Efficiency and Reliable Thermal Design

  • Base Power Consumption: 12 watts
  • Maximum Power Consumption: 80 watts

Built on a 4nm process, the Snapdragon X Elite X1E-80-100 delivers efficient energy usage and dependable heat management, ensuring long-term reliability under heavy workloads.
